"Play to find out" - That goes a bit further than what you suggest of 'don't ask the GM what's going on but figure it out through play.' That's a core tenant of Apocalypse World, and games (both PbtA and otherwise) that share that game's core philosophy. It's short for "play to find out what happens," and is a reminder that the GM shouldn't go in with a predecided end point in mind, but instead to be responsive to what the players are doing (though what that means, specifically, will vary heavily from game to game - Monster of the Week, which I think is relatively prep-heavy for PbtA, has you going in with basically the entirety of the mystery already planned, and what will happen if the PCs don't interfere written out, but IIRC you wouldn't dictate where the climax happens, or the route the investigators are going to take to get to it within that game), but also for the players to not pre-plan how their characters will develop, but let their character development respond organically to what's happening. It's the PbtA (and related game) equivalent of OSR/NSR's 'story is what we tell after the game' and the general advice of 'prep problems not plots'

Blades In the Dark is heavily, HEAVILY mechanically tied to its theme of a punk-Victorianesque gang criminal underworld maneuvering. The core philosophy of all Forged in the Dark style games is to center roleplay and simulate the emotional experience of a point of view through mechanics. Many of us are used to 5e which seeks to lessen the importance of themes to give players a more universally applicable system (although of course it is NOT universally applicable, and does have a genre bent through its mechanics, it’s just been de-emphasized over time), so we may forget that some other mechanical systems are not smoothly reskinnable. A huge amount of the BItD rulebook is location and faction information for the city, and the society of the specific world that results in a pressure cooker of poverty, discontent, and crime. Another huge chunk goes in great depth to describe the structure of a cinematic heist and how to embrace the nature of a scrappy, short-lived scoundrel to push yourself to claw your way to the top, and how those tie together. The bulk of the rules descriptions are about setting limitations on your character in the context of heists, crimes, and negotiations to try to put pressure on you to look cunning and scrappy. The rules about dice pools could almost entirely be described by the character sheets themselves. So no, not really. If you want to play Candela Obscura, a game about investigating the dangerous and unknowable paranormal in an atmosphere of oppressive mystery, Blades In the Dark would be quite inadequate to your needs. I can tell you this simply as a GM of Blades. Perhaps a different Forged in the Dark system would get you close, but we are allowed to have similar experiences with different systems. For instance, I just bought the Dishonored RPG, which I anticipate to deliver a similar experience to Blades, which lists Dishonored as an atmospheric reference.

As much as I have to commend them from the artwork, the rules for this game are awful. Death is practically nonexistent due to the ludicrous amount of dice you can add to rolls to fix bad rolls, there is no rules for combat (especially pvp combat. The game literally tells the GM to just make something up), it takes a lot of rules straight from blades in the dark, the worldbuilding and setting is practically a utopian society, and many many other flaws Save your money on this one people as there are much better options. If you want a game set in this theme that’s horror themed just go buy Call of Cthulhu. It’s better in almost every single way.
